## Step 4: Update your image cache bindings

Version 3 of the Pictora SDK fixes a leak where evicted bitmaps kept a reference through the decode callback, so long-running plugins grew unbounded. If your plugin subclasses the cache, remove any manual eviction hooks — the runtime handles release now. Plugins still targeting v2 will compile but leak; migrate before the v2 shutoff. After updating, verify memory stays flat under the bundled soak test. The cache initializes with the settings listed below.

config for bawig-fadup:
[zorix]
host = zorix.lumicworks.corp
user = zorix_svc
database = zorix_prod

The Fernwick service wraps all calls to the Tallowgate pricing API in a circuit breaker. When the failure ratio crosses threshold within the rolling window, the breaker opens and requests fall back to cached quotes for the cool-down period, then half-opens with probe traffic. Do not manually force the breaker closed during an upstream incident; let probes confirm recovery first. For this week's sync, note that staging and production diverge intentionally. The production values are reproduced below.

deployment values, bahop-yadug:
[caswyn]
port = 8443
region = east-4
host = caswyn.lumicworks.internal
timeout_ms = 5000
retries = 8

Handover Note — Lease Renegotiation

Quick one before you start: the Farrowgate warehouse lease is up in March, and the landlord, Pellman Estates, is pushing a steep increase. We've countered with a shorter term plus a break clause. Everything else is in the file. The strategic angle is summarised below.

board note of bawep-tajef: Queniusek Systems plans to raise the Quenvan list price by 53.1 percent in March. The pricing group signed off on a budget of $176.4 million for Project Drueth. The renewal with Casionix Partners closes at $142.5 million a year, 8.3 percent below the last contract. Project Fraax slips by six weeks because of the tooling delay.